Understanding Gum Contouring: What Is It?

Gum contouring, also known as gum reshaping or gingivectomy, is a cosmetic dental procedure that removes excess gum tissue to create a more balanced, symmetrical smile line. The goal is to expose more of the natural tooth structure, making teeth appear longer and more proportionate. It is particularly effective for patients with a “gummy smile” (where more than 3–4 mm of gum tissue shows), uneven gum levels, or a “toothy” appearance due to receding gums. The procedure can be performed using a scalpel, laser, or electrosurgery, with laser contouring being the most popular for its precision, reduced bleeding, and faster healing.

In the UK, gum contouring is considered a cosmetic treatment and is rarely available on the NHS unless it addresses a functional issue, such as gum disease or trauma. Private UK clinics charge between £250 and £600 per tooth, with full arch treatments averaging £2,000 to £5,000. For patients requiring multiple teeth, these costs can be prohibitive. The Gum Contouring Procedure: Step-by-Step

Understanding what happens during gum contouring can alleviate anxiety and help you prepare. Here is a typical process at a reputable Antalya clinic.

#### Initial Consultation and Assessment

Your journey begins with a thorough consultation, often conducted virtually before you travel. A dentist will review your medical history, take digital X-rays and photographs, and discuss your aesthetic goals. They will assess your gum health, tooth-to-gum ratio, and smile line. This is crucial to ensure you are a suitable candidate – for example, patients with active gum disease or insufficient tooth structure may need alternative treatments.

#### Treatment Planning

Using advanced imaging software, the dentist will create a digital simulation of your new smile. This allows you to visualise the final result and make adjustments before any procedure begins. The plan will map out exactly which teeth need reshaping and how much gum tissue will be removed.

#### The Procedure

On the day of treatment, a local anaesthetic is administered to numb the gums. For laser contouring – the standard at top clinics – a dental laser is used to precisely remove excess tissue. The laser simultaneously seals blood vessels, minimising bleeding and reducing the risk of infection. The procedure typ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our for a full arch, depending on the complexity. Patients report feeling pressure but no pain.

#### Recovery and Aftercare

Post-procedure, you may experience mild swelling, tenderness, or sensitivity for a few days. Over-the-counter pain relief and cold compresses are usually sufficient. You will be advised to eat soft foods (yoghurt, soups, mashed potatoes) for 24–48 hours, avoid hot or spicy foods, and maintain gentle oral hygiene. Most patients return to normal activities within 2–3 days, though full healing of the gum tissue takes 2–4 weeks. Your dentist will provide detailed aftercare instructions and schedule a follow-up (often virtual) to monitor healing.

Recovery and Results: What to Expect

Gum contouring offers immediate visual improvement, but final results take time. Immediately after the procedure, your gums will appear slightly swollen and may look darker or more red. Over the next few days, swelling subsides, and the gums heal to a natural pink colour. The new gum line should be visible within 2–4 weeks.

The results of gum contouring are permanent, as gum tissue does not grow back. However, maintaining good oral hygiene and regular dental check-ups is essential to prevent gum disease, which can alter the gum line.
